Description

This is a fun, if brief, line that ascends a blocky face with a high crux that is harder than it looks.

Fire up blocky terrain. Near the top, balance your way to the top utilizing the arete blob.

Location

This is to the left of Protection from the Virus.

Protection

#0.5 & #0.75 Camalots with a #0.2 Camalot directional near the top works for anchors. This is leadable with a rack from #0.1 to #3 Camalots.
